ABOUT
Global CyberLympic's headquarters is located in Albuquerque, New Mexico, USA 87109. Global CyberLympic has an estimated 10 employees and an estimated annual revenue of 10.0M.... There are no competitors identified for Global CyberLympic
There have been no acquisitions found related to Global CyberLympic
Funding data cannot be found related to Global CyberLympic
Recent investment data cannot be found related to Global CyberLympic